The Monroe and Main Slimming Sassy Dress is what I would consider a fall wardrobe staple. The dress has such an effortless, yet chic look to it. The three quarter length sleeve is absolutely perfect for the changing season. I'm not opposed to layering, but it's so nice to now have a beautiful dress in my collection, that I don't have to hide with a sweater, because my arms are too chilly in the early morning or in the evening.
Shall I practice my curtsy? I feel pretty enough to take tea with Queen Elizabeth!
I might have uttered a little 'hallelujah,' when I realized how seamlessly I was able to move in this dress. It's a nice blend of rayon and spandex, so it's nice and flowy at the bottom, fitted at the top, and it moves with me, instead of against me. There is nothing worse or more uncomfortable that wearing a dress that you wind up having to fight with.
The Slimming Sassy Dress hits in all the right places.
It's so nice to find a dress that flatters your entire body. I am a bit disproportioned, as I have a short middle, small bust, and long legs. I often have a problem with dressed fitting me well enough across the chest, and leaving enough room to wear comfortably in the hips. Monroe and Main's Slimming Sassy Dress features a surplice neckline, and an empire waistband. The combination of these two elements make me look like I actually have a fuller bust, and I love that!
